The Dallas Birddogs biggest rivals are apparently the London Royals... something about them joining the league together, but anyways if the Birddogs lost against them (which they didn't in their most recent win against them *wink*), the team would be absolutely distraught. Especially if the game was an important game, the team hates to lose. You would see the veterans and captains (oh wait that's me) trying to keep the spirits high while some of the players are down after what should have been an easy win. Saying things like "we'll have them next time" and "hey just blow some steam off in the gym," the team with the help of the coaching staff tries to regroup for the next big game because every game counts. After the post-game cooldown and training, most players have their mind set on the next game already, while the straggling few still need the night to recover. Whether it be food, drinks, gaming, or a combination of those, the team bands together once again to focus up after a tough loss.
Beniri T'Chawama as the captain of the team in his rookie season is still learning the ropes from the veterans but he is much better at coping with losses compared to others. It might have been the teams that he has been on in the past, but losses don't really phase the rookie captain as he helps to keep the team spirits high. With a positive attitude and a few jokes shared between the team, he knows what it takes to be a leader and although he isn't the best, he will get there. An important thing for that is definitely knowing how to bounce back after a tough loss such as one against the London Royals.
